当前位置: 首页 > news >正文

DS4Windows终极控制器冲突解决指南:3步告别游戏手柄识别难题

DS4Windows终极控制器冲突解决指南:3步告别游戏手柄识别难题

【免费下载链接】DS4WindowsLike those other ds4tools, but sexier项目地址: https://gitcode.com/gh_mirrors/ds/DS4Windows

你是否遇到过PS4手柄连接电脑后按键错乱,或者游戏完全无法识别控制器的困扰?Windows系统下游戏控制器驱动冲突是许多玩家的噩梦,但有了DS4Windows这个强大的开源工具,一切都能迎刃而解。本文将为你提供一套简单有效的3步解决方案,彻底解决DS4、DualSense、Switch Pro等控制器的驱动兼容性问题。

一、快速识别:你的控制器遇到了什么冲突?

在深入解决方案之前,让我们先看看常见的控制器冲突症状。理解问题表现能帮助你快速定位根源。

1.1 常见冲突症状自检表

症状表现可能原因紧急程度
按键映射错乱多个软件同时修改控制器设置⭐⭐⭐
手柄频繁断开重连蓝牙干扰或驱动抢占⭐⭐⭐⭐
游戏完全不识别控制器虚拟驱动未正确创建⭐⭐⭐⭐⭐
输入延迟明显增加系统资源被多个进程争抢⭐⭐
陀螺仪功能失效特殊功能驱动兼容问题⭐⭐⭐

1.2 系统级错误示例

有时候问题出在Windows系统层面。比如设备管理器中控制器被禁用:

当你看到"HID-compliant game controller"旁边有向下箭头图标时,说明系统已经禁用了这个设备。这是典型的驱动冲突表现之一。

二、冲突根源:为什么Windows会有控制器兼容问题?

2.1 多软件争夺控制权

Windows系统默认将游戏手柄识别为标准HID设备,但不同游戏和软件对控制器的处理方式各不相同:

  • Steam输入系统:即使你关闭了Steam的控制器支持,后台服务仍可能持续监控设备
  • Xbox应用:微软自家的游戏服务也会尝试接管控制器
  • 其他映射工具:如JoyToKey、Xpadder等可能残留配置

2.2 虚拟驱动创建失败

DS4Windows的核心功能是将PS4、PS5等控制器虚拟为Xbox 360控制器,让Windows游戏能够识别。这个过程需要ViGEmBus虚拟驱动正常工作。

从上图可以看到,DS4Windows界面清晰地显示了已连接的控制器状态、电池电量和当前使用的配置文件。如果这个界面无法显示你的控制器,通常意味着虚拟驱动创建失败。

三、3步解决方案:从根源解决控制器冲突

步骤1:清理系统环境,排除干扰因素

在安装DS4Windows之前,先确保系统环境干净:

  1. 关闭所有可能冲突的软件

    • 完全退出Steam(包括后台进程)
    • 关闭Xbox Game Bar和Xbox应用
    • 停止其他控制器映射工具
  2. 检查设备管理器状态

    • 打开设备管理器(Win+X,选择"设备管理器")
    • 展开"人机界面设备"
    • 确保没有控制器被禁用(如上图所示)
  3. 卸载冲突驱动

    • 如果之前安装过其他控制器工具,建议完全卸载
    • 使用驱动清理工具移除残留的虚拟驱动

步骤2:正确安装DS4Windows和依赖组件

正确的安装顺序至关重要:

先决条件安装

  • Microsoft .NET 8.0 Desktop Runtime(x64或x86版本)
  • Visual C++ 2015-2022 Redistributable

DS4Windows安装步骤

  1. 从官方发布页面下载最新版本
  2. 解压到任意目录(建议不要放在系统盘)
  3. 首次运行DS4Windows时,它会自动检测并安装ViGEmBus驱动
  4. 按照向导完成初始配置

关键配置点

  • 在设置中启用"独占模式"(Exclusive Mode)
  • 根据需要配置HidHide集成(防止其他软件干扰)
  • 创建适合你游戏习惯的配置文件

步骤3:配置优化与冲突预防

3.1 Steam冲突彻底解决

即使你不在Steam中玩游戏,Steam的控制器服务也可能造成干扰:

  1. 全局设置调整

    • Steam → 设置 → 控制器 → 常规控制器设置
    • 取消勾选所有配置支持:
      • ❌ PlayStation配置支持
      • ❌ Xbox配置支持
      • ❌ 通用控制器配置支持
  2. 游戏特定配置

    • 右键游戏 → 属性 → 控制器
    • 选择"禁用Steam输入"
3.2 HidHide驱动隔离技术

对于高级用户,HidHide提供了更彻底的隔离方案:

  1. 从DS4Windows欢迎界面下载HidHide
  2. 以管理员身份安装并重启系统
  3. 配置设备隐藏
    • 只对DS4Windows程序开放控制器访问权限
    • 阻止其他所有软件看到物理控制器
3.3 配置文件管理技巧

DS4Windows的配置文件系统非常强大:

![Xbox 360控制器布局](https://raw.gitcode.com/gh_mirrors/ds/DS4Windows/raw/f04497142ff5660455f6181297ff706622c4b20e/DS4Windows/Resources/360 map.png?utm_source=gitcode_repo_files)

了解标准Xbox 360控制器的布局有助于你创建更准确的映射。每个按钮都有标准的Xbox对应关系,DS4Windows会自动处理这些转换。

配置文件创建建议

  • 为不同类型的游戏创建不同配置文件(FPS、RPG、赛车等)
  • 利用"自动配置文件"功能,让DS4Windows根据运行的游戏自动切换配置
  • 定期备份你的配置文件,防止意外丢失

四、特殊场景处理:进阶问题解决方案

4.1 多手柄同时连接

当连接多个控制器时,可能会遇到识别混乱的问题:

解决方案

  1. 在DS4Windows设置中增加输出槽数量
  2. 为每个手柄创建独立的配置文件
  3. 使用"链接配置文件到控制器ID"功能

4.2 蓝牙与USB混合使用

如果你经常在蓝牙和有线连接之间切换:

  1. 启用"快速切换"功能:自动处理连接方式变更
  2. 保持固件更新:确保蓝牙适配器驱动最新
  3. 电源管理优化:防止USB端口省电导致断开

4.3 特定游戏兼容性问题

某些游戏可能需要特殊处理:

  • 老游戏:可能需要启用"强制XInput"模式
  • 模拟器:可能需要调整轮询率设置
  • VR游戏:可能需要关闭陀螺仪模拟

五、日常维护与故障排除

5.1 定期维护清单

保持系统健康运行,建议每月检查:

  • 验证ViGEmBus驱动版本是否为最新
  • 检查DS4Windows日志中是否有异常警告
  • 清理设备管理器中的隐藏设备
  • 备份当前所有配置文件
  • 测试所有控制器功能是否正常

5.2 快速故障排除流程

遇到问题时,按此顺序排查:

  1. 基础检查

    • 控制器是否充电充足?
    • USB线缆是否完好?
    • 蓝牙适配器是否正常工作?
  2. DS4Windows检查

    • 查看主界面是否识别到控制器
    • 检查日志页面是否有错误信息
    • 验证配置文件是否正确加载
  3. 系统级检查

    • 设备管理器中控制器状态
    • 系统事件查看器相关错误
    • 其他可能冲突的软件

5.3 日志分析与诊断

DS4Windows提供了详细的日志功能,位于软件界面的"日志"标签页。重点关注:

  • "Exclusive Mode failed":独占模式失败,通常是其他程序占用
  • "Device access denied":设备访问被拒绝,权限问题
  • "Virtual controller created":虚拟控制器创建成功,说明核心功能正常

六、效果验证与长期优化

6.1 解决方案效果验证

完成所有配置后,你应该看到:

  • ✅ 控制器在DS4Windows界面稳定显示
  • ✅ 游戏能够正确识别并响应输入
  • ✅ 按键映射准确无误
  • ✅ 无线连接稳定不频繁断开
  • ✅ 特殊功能(陀螺仪、触摸板)正常工作

6.2 性能优化建议

为了获得最佳游戏体验:

  1. 轮询率设置

    • 普通游戏:250Hz或500Hz
    • 竞技游戏:1000Hz(如果支持)
  2. 延迟优化

    • 启用"高优先级"模式
    • 关闭不必要的后台程序
    • 使用有线连接降低延迟
  3. 电池管理

    • 设置低电量警告阈值
    • 配置自动关闭时间
    • 使用官方充电设备

6.3 社区资源与支持

DS4Windows拥有活跃的社区支持:

  • 官方文档:doc/dev/ 目录包含开发者文档
  • 用户指南:USERGUIDE.md 提供详细使用说明
  • GitCode仓库:获取最新版本和问题反馈

结语:享受无缝的游戏体验

通过这3步解决方案,你应该能够彻底解决Windows下的控制器驱动冲突问题。DS4Windows的强大之处在于它不仅解决了兼容性问题,还提供了丰富的自定义功能,让你的游戏体验更加个性化。

记住,控制器冲突的本质是资源争夺,而DS4Windows配合正确的配置策略,能够为你创建一个干净、稳定的控制器环境。无论是PS4、PS5、Switch Pro还是JoyCon控制器,现在都能在Windows上完美工作。

开始享受你的游戏时光吧!如果遇到特别复杂的问题,DS4Windows的日志功能和社区支持都是你强大的后盾。祝你游戏愉快! 🎮

【免费下载链接】DS4WindowsLike those other ds4tools, but sexier项目地址: https://gitcode.com/gh_mirrors/ds/DS4Windows

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/724105/

相关文章:

  • 2026年目前军用电源品牌,新能源车载逆变电源/高功率密度电源/全国产化电源/新能源车载直流转换器,军用电源品牌有哪些 - 品牌推荐师
  • Python单行代码提速数据分析的7个实用技巧
  • 从设计到打印:Blender 3MF插件如何重塑你的3D打印工作流
  • ComfyUI-Manager:AI工作流管理的终极解决方案
  • 终极指南:如何在Windows系统上免费搭建虚拟串口调试环境
  • ARMv8/v9异常处理与FAR_ELx寄存器解析
  • MMMU基准测试:多模态大模型的“全科考试”与本地实践指南
  • 2026食品包装设计公司靠谱不贵推荐,食品厂家做包装高性价比优选 - 设计调研者
  • 音节划分规则(雪梨)
  • 终极浏览器资源嗅探:猫抓Cat-Catch完整使用指南
  • ▲基于双深度Qlearning强化学习(DDQN)的稀疏圆阵非均匀阵列位置优化算法matlab仿真
  • Windows DLL注入终极指南:如何用Xenos在5分钟内掌握进程注入技术
  • 留学生降AI评测:实测3款去AIGC痕迹工具,告诉你英文论文降AI到底怎么选
  • 复盘:从0到1构建RAG文档问答系统
  • AI编程新战场:模型之上,“Agent Harness“如何颠覆开发体验?
  • 茉莉花Zotero插件:中文文献管理的终极解决方案
  • 老板们,一定要搞定您公司的龙虾记忆分层
  • MockGPS位置模拟:Android设备GPS伪装终极指南
  • 想知道欧拉5和宝马iX1谁更值得买?看完对比你就心中有数!
  • 教育视频知识留存率提升方法与实践
  • RimSort终极指南:轻松解决《环世界》模组冲突与排序难题
  • (2026最新)留学生降论文AI率实战:3款防误判工具盘点与评测
  • 从发票伪造到数据生成:合规测试数据工厂的构建与实践
  • 4. Token(词元),5分钟彻底搞懂
  • CCAA外审员考试科目有哪些 - 众智商学院官方
  • 2026年地埋式一体化泵站权威推荐榜单:一体化污水提升泵站设备/一体化地埋式泵站/一体化泵站价格源头厂家精选 - 泵站报价15613348888
  • 告别传感器依赖:用CMT实现自动驾驶3D检测的‘单目’与‘纯激光’自由切换
  • GESP2025年6月认证C++五级( 第三部分编程题(1、奖品兑换))
  • 基于Vue 3与Spring Boot的腾讯云CVM管理平台设计与实现
  • 从0到1掌握AI产品开发:5阶段进阶指南,打造爆款AI应用!